What happened

ali0813192020

I was so delighted to find such a good app for searching for housing and/or flat mates. Initially the app was free to use but that all changed with the upgrade. Now one must pay be it 7 day, 2 weeks, a month.....just to PM anyone on the site. It’s not useful nor productive by any means. I don’t see the reason why the developers set it this way. Does anyone know why?

People are rude, play with your head

therealjkillah

I started looking for a place on this app in September 2020. It is now March 2021. I went to multiple places and most people were extremely rude and judgmental. You’re lucky if they even respond to you. One time I was all ready to rent a room out, just for the woman (who was my age) to tell me she had already rented the room out. So why did you have me come over? How is someone moving in when you told me you don’t even know the cost of security deposit? A lot of people seemed like they wanted to meet me for their own entertainment just to play with my head and then never talk to me again. I’ve been looked at like I have 3 heads and 6 arms. I did absolutely nothing wrong and was always kind to everyone. I deleted my profile picture so people won’t judge me. Don’t even know what picture to use because I became really hurt and self conscious. I knew it would be hard to find a place to live but I never knew it would be this hard. I am trying one more time to see if I can find some good people renting rooms out. I’m frustrated, but hopeful. Otherwise, the app works and is easy to navigate. I like the layout and design of the app and it’s easy to find places to rent in the area(s) you’re looking at. I met maybe 2 nice people in the fall but I was still unable to rent from them. If you use this app, be careful what personal info you give out. Be nice, and hopefully they’ll be nice back. Or they’ll just ignore you.
